The Invisible Invaders: Understanding Dust Mites
Dust mites are microscopic arachnids, invisible to the naked eye, thriving in warm and humid environments. They primarily feed on dead human skin cells shed daily. These tiny creatures inhabit common household items such as mattresses, pillows, carpets, upholstered furniture, and curtains. Despite their minuscule size—typically about 0.2 to 0.3 millimeters—they exist in massive numbers; a single gram of dust can contain thousands of dust mites.
Their prevalence is nearly universal in human dwellings worldwide, especially in temperate climates where indoor humidity levels are moderate to high. Dust mites do not bite or sting humans and do not transmit diseases. However, their presence becomes problematic due to the proteins found in their feces and body fragments, which are potent allergens.

The Biology Behind Allergies
The allergens come from proteins found in dust mite feces and decomposed body parts. When inhaled or coming into contact with mucous membranes like those in the nose or eyes, these proteins stimulate an immune response.
The immune system mistakenly identifies these proteins as harmful invaders and releases histamines and other chemicals to fight them off. This reaction causes inflammation and irritation of tissues lining the respiratory tract.
Repeated exposure over time can lead to chronic inflammation and heightened sensitivity—creating a vicious cycle for allergy sufferers.

Where Do Dust Mites Thrive? Identifying Hotspots
Dust mites prefer environments that provide warmth (around 20-25°C) with relative humidity above 50%. Their favorite hangouts include:
- Bedding: Mattresses, pillows, sheets—where skin flakes accumulate.
- Upholstered Furniture: Sofas and chairs trap dust particles easily.
- Carpets & Rugs: Fibers collect dead skin cells creating ideal feeding grounds.
- Curtains & Drapes: Fabric surfaces hold moisture aiding mite survival.
Since humans shed millions of skin flakes daily—an abundant food source—dust mites multiply rapidly if conditions are right.
The Role of Humidity
Humidity plays a critical role in dust mite survival because they absorb water vapor from the air rather than drinking liquid water directly. Indoor humidity levels above 50% create optimal breeding grounds.
Conversely, maintaining relative humidity below 50% inhibits their ability to thrive by dehydrating them over time.
Tackling Dust Mites: Proven Strategies for Control
While eradicating dust mites completely is unrealistic due to their microscopic size and resilience, controlling their population effectively reduces allergen levels dramatically. Here’s how:
Bedding Management
Since bedding is a primary habitat for dust mites:
- Use allergen-proof mattress and pillow covers: These encasements prevent mites from penetrating bedding surfaces.
- Launder bedding weekly: Wash sheets, pillowcases, blankets in hot water (at least 130°F/54°C) to kill mites.
- Avoid feather pillows: Synthetic alternatives harbor fewer mites.
Chemical Treatments
Some acaricides (mite-killing substances) exist but should be used cautiously due to potential health risks. Natural alternatives like tannic acid sprays can denature allergens without harming humans or pets.

The Link Between Dust Mites and Asthma Severity
Research shows that exposure to dust mite allergens significantly worsens asthma symptoms in sensitized individuals. The inhalation of allergenic particles triggers airway inflammation causing bronchoconstriction—a narrowing of airways—that leads to wheezing and breathlessness.
In clinical studies:
- Asthmatic patients exposed long-term to high levels of dust mite allergens experience increased frequency of attacks.
- Dust mite reduction strategies correlate with fewer hospital visits related to asthma exacerbations.
- Sensitized children show improved lung function following environmental control measures targeting dust mites.
This evidence underscores why managing indoor allergen levels must be part of comprehensive asthma care plans for affected individuals.

The Importance of Air Filtration Systems
High-efficiency particulate air (HEPA) filters installed in HVAC systems or portable air purifiers capture airborne allergens including dust mite fragments effectively. This reduces inhalation exposure especially during sleeping hours when people spend extended time indoors breathing recycled air.
Choosing units with verified HEPA certification ensures maximum efficiency at trapping tiny particles down to submicron sizes—the range where most allergens fall.
